Web24 de set. de 2024 · The averages for 12-year-olds are 89 pounds, for males, and 92 pounds, for females. However, beyond biological sex, many other factors influence … Twelve-year-old boys most often weigh somewhere between 67 and 130 pounds, with 89 pounds marking the 50th percentile. Ver mais Girls at age 12 most often weigh between 68 and 135 pounds, with 92 pounds being the 50th-percentile marker. Ver mais

Web12 de dez. de 2024 · A child is within the healthy range if her BMI is between the fifth and 85th percentile. Overweight children fall between the 85th and 95th percentile, and obese children have a BMI equal to or …
Web17 de jul. de 2024 · According to the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) , a 12-year-old boy’s weight usually falls between 67 and 130 pounds, and the 50th percentile weight for boys is 89 pounds. According to the Centers for Disease Control, the CDC, the average weight for a 12-year-old boy is 90 pounds. At this age, boys in the top 10 percent weigh about 120 pounds or more while those in the lower 10 percent weigh about 70 pounds or less.
